SOCIAL MEDIA POLICY

Arizona State Parks strongly believes that social media is a tool for consumers and communities to receive updates. We encourage interaction and discussion on any of our posts.

We believe firmly that social media must be a safe space for all participants to engage in full and fair dialogue. All posters are encouraged to agree or disagree on any positions on any of our social media outlets. We remind individuals who post, that children, youth and families have access to all of these posts and we want to maximize participation that is free from intimidation or bullying.

Name-calling, intimidation or bullying of other social media participants will never be tolerated. Abusive, excessively disruptive and harassing posts will also be considered prohibitive of the fair and safe space we intend to maintain. Posts with unrelated information or political agendas will be removed. We will monitor communications and take appropriate action in order to ensure that these policies are consistently adhered to.

Due to the excessive heat and dry windy conditions in combination with tall dry grasses, Dead Horse Ranch State Park will be implementing Fire Restrictions beginning on Thursday 6/29/2017. No open flames will be allowed, no campfires, no cooking with charcoal, no smoking outside of vehicles. Propane is allowed. Common name is Red-tailed hawk. Scientific name is Buteo jamaicensis. Our most common hawk, their habitat is variable prefers woods with open land, also plains, prairie groves, and desert. Preys on rodents.

Common name is Desert Rhubarb. Scientific name is Rumex hymenosepalus. Found in sandy areas, and belongs to the Buckwheat family.

Greater Roadrunner whom belongs to the Cuckoo family. A formidable predator that can run up to 15 mph to catch prey. This little critter eats insects, reptiles, small mammals, and birds.
